Glycerol ACS (CAS: 56-81-5) is a colorless, odorless, and syrupy liquid at ambient temperature. It is a non-volatile liquid with a mild taste. It can easily be blended with alcohol and water, but is insoluble in some usual organic solvents. It tends to draw moisture from the air and has a high boiling point under typical circumstances. This alcohol is formed through triglyceride breakdown or as a secondary product during soap and biodiesel production. The chemical formula for this alcohol is C3H8O3. It is also known as glycerin. Glycerin ACS is widely applied in industrial and laboratory applications.

Applications of Glycerol ACS Grade

Glycerol ACS is utilized both in the preparation of samples and the formation of gel for pol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is.

Since Glycerol ACS is antiviral and antimicrobial, it is commonly utilized in treating wounds and burns.

It can even be present in inks and adhesives. It is an essential ingredient in the production of plastics and resins.
